Are the rest of the Colin Baker episodes of "Doctor Who" coming to iTunes?

They have every episode of his except for "Attack of the Cybermen" and "Revelation of the Daleks," and since he's my favorite Doctor I would really love to have all his episodes on my iTunes! Is there a reason those two story arcs aren't available? Is it some sort of rights thing? I can't say that seems likely as the DVDs of those two arcs are pretty common, but I'm more of an iTunes guy, now so if anyone has any information whether or not these last two remaining Classic Doctor Who stories from the sixth incarnation are coming to iTunes I'd be very happy to know when I can buy them! 🙂

Apple can only sell content that they have the rights to sell - unless the rights-holders pass those two stories to Apple and grant Apple a license to sell them in your country then Apple won't be able to sell them there. If/when that might happen we won't know - you can try requesting that they be added, but it needs the rights-holders to agree : http://www.apple.com/feedback/itunes.html
